Output 26423a6aeb77c405d4e403aca9b646d7b59e4f32e68d0eeb07e4ed184437f7d5:1

value
3767165
script pubkey
OP_0 OP_PUSHBYTES_20 1a8e18867d399abc6d79cd5a919af62bb560eb80
address
bc1qr28p3pna8xdtcmtee4dfrxhk9w6kp6uqrk9hdw
transaction
26423a6aeb77c405d4e403aca9b646d7b59e4f32e68d0eeb07e4ed184437f7d5